Scripture: Isaiah 45 v 2: "I will go before thee, and make the crooked places straight: I will break in pieces the the gates of brass, and cut in sunder the bars of iron."
Luke 3 v 4 - 6: "As it is written in the book of the words of Esaias the prophet, saying, The voice of one crying in the wilderness, Prepare ye the way of the Lord, make his paths straight.
5 Every valley shall be filled, and every mountain and hill shall be brought low; and the crooked shall be made straight, and the rough ways shall be made smooth;
6 And all flesh shall see the salvation of God."
The Lord has undertaken a mighty task in taking every person who is born again to change them from crooked to straight and from rough to smooth. He employs His followers in this huge effort to pray for, teach, warn and encourage those who are coming out of darkness into His light.
Without Jesus going before us these barriers are impossible to clear out of our way. He sees beforehand the obstacles in our path and asks us to walk in His footsteps to avoid spiritual landmines. These are laid by our sly enemy who wants to cause us to slip up so he can accuse us before God. The name Satan means Accuser of the Brethren.
Jesus is our Advocate before the Father. It means when the enemy is accusing the born again saints, He is taking the blame for us. If our names are written in the Lamb's Book of Life then our sins are all forgiven and our Father looks on the righteousness of His Son and says "Case Dismissed" to Satan.
In this world we can be deceived by those who lurk in crooked places to trip us and catch us in their schemes. Jesus makes a straight path of honesty and truth to teach sinners to know there is a better way. We must renew the way we think to break wrong thought patterns that lead us to compromise.
It is the gates of brass that block us spiritually from growing in grace through faith. Jesus will break them into pieces when we pray to get past them. We may have ignorantly backed ourselves into these problems. So ask Him for every blockage we have erected to be shattered.
Soulish prayers can cause people to be hindered by these gates of brass. They are prayers that are our will for them rather than God's will. When we feel someone should be punished for causing us a problem we feel justified in laying it on thick. However, the Lord may have an entirely different way of dealing with it. Rather find His will and be in agreement with Him.
The bars of iron speak of imprisonment, captivity and bondage. When we are freed from sin we have leverage to pray for Jesus to burst these bars asunder. He will reveal the hidden layers of ancestral curses and set us free. We carry the unknown baggage of past generations into our present lives. Jesus cancels it all when we ask Him to do so. The release can be a bit turbulent at times but when its over we know we are free.
He is the mighty conqueror of this world and the Creator of every being. Nothing is too hard for Him to do. He reveals to those who pray the things that need shattering and removing. The Lord raises up those who have struggled and fills them with joy. He always has an answer to the most difficult problems.
He also makes the rough places smooth. We all start off with some rough edges - we get angry, shout, rant, sulk, throw things and Jesus needs to calm us down to be like Him. He did all that too against those who desecrated the Temple and made His Father's house a place of business. That was righteous anger. The anger that is just bad temper and rage needs that rough edge to be smoothed.
Jesus does not hurry this work in us. He does it slowly, thoroughly and to perfection. So invite Him to sort out anything in our lives that needs fixing and it will be done in a beautiful way. We may have to do some spiritual wrestling though, some roots have grown deep. Think of digging up an old tree in the garden and how much heaving and shoving will be needed. That's how some of these demonic roots need to be dealt with.
Ephesians 6 v 12 - 13: "For we wrestle not against flesh and blood, but against principalities, against powers, against the rulers of the darkness of this world, against spiritual wickedness in high places.
13 Wherefore take unto you the whole armour of God, that ye may be able to withstand in the evil day, and having done all, to stand."
Just be informed and ready to be used by the Holy Spirit in any situation that arises. Be prayed up all the time so that instant action is not delayed. The Lord is always with us to help.
